陆军部队作战能力评估方法及指标权重计算

针对现代战争条件下陆军作战部队评估指标繁多,难以综合和定量评估的问题,将难以量化的综合指标逐级分解为易于量化的性能指标,构建陆军部队作战能力的三级评价体系,最底层的指标可根据部队装备和评估科目灵活设置.通过各层级指标之间的相关性分析,使用网络分析法(ANP)进行聚合,得出作战部队的六维能力图.聚合后的指标数据利用ANP-熵权法计算组合权重,在保证决策者经验的基础上考虑数据客观性,得出作战能力综合评估结果.
Evaluation Method and Index Weight Calculation for Combat Capability of Army Forces
To solve the problem of numerous evaluation indicators of combat forces in modern warfare,which are difficult to evaluate comprehensively and quantitatively,the comprehensive indicators that are difficult to be quantifed are decomposed into performance indicators that are easy to be quantifed level by level,and a three-level evaluation system for the combat capability of the army forces is constructed.The lowest level evalua-tion indicators can be flexibly set according to the military equipment and evaluation subjects.Through the corre-lation analysis of indicators at all levels,the network analysis process(ANP)is used to make aggregation,and the six dimensional capability map of combat forces is obtained.The combined weight of aggregated index data is cal-culated with ANP-entropy weight method.On the basis of ensuring the experience of decision-makers,the data objectivity is considered,and the comprehensive evaluation results of combat capability are obtained.
